Compare all specifications:
1996 De Tomaso Pantera | 1989 Oldsmobile Ninety-Eight | |
Make | De Tomaso | Oldsmobile |
Model | Pantera | Ninety-Eight |
Year Released | 1996 | 1989 |
Engine Position | Middle | Front |
Engine Size | 5761 cc | 3791 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Horse Power | 350 HP | 163 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 5200 RPM |
Torque | 460 Nm | 285 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 2000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Vehicle Weight | 1422 kg | 1510 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4370 mm | 5010 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1990 mm | 1850 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1110 mm | 1410 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2520 mm | 2830 mm |
